Four-H is a community of youth across America who are learning leadership, citizenship, and life skills. As Extension Agent, 4-H Youth Development, my role is to provide non-formal learning experiences for youth, ages 5-18. We utilize a variety of delivery modes: in-school clubs for 4th and 5th graders, after-school science clubs, community clubs, project clubs, and special interest clubs. During the summer months, we offer day camps, 4-H camp, and State 4-H Congress. There are many learning experiences available for youth, ranging from leadership, to livestock, to robotics.
